Popular State Parks Near Mary Esther, FL

Topsail Hill Preserve State Park is a stunning destination situated just 2.562 miles away from Mary Esther, Florida. The park offers RV campers a chance to experience nature while enjoying modern amenities. With more than 150 campsites available, Topsail Hill Preserve State Park provides RVers with electric, sewer and water hookups, as well as laundry facilities and restrooms. Be sure to make a reservation in advance if you plan on camping here.Henderson Beach State Park is another must-visit park near Mary Esther. This park overlooks the Gulf of Mexico and boasts over 60 campsites for RVers with electric and water hookups available. The park also features picnic pavilions, restroom facilities, and playgrounds for kids.If you're looking for a place to fish or kayak, Fred Gannon Rocky Bayou State Park should be on your list. Established in 1966, this park offers visitors an opportunity to enjoy freshwater fishing and other outdoor activities such as canoeing and kayaking. For RVers, the campsite has both electric and water hookups available.These state parks near Mary Esther provide travelers with an excellent opportunity to enjoy the beauty of Florida's natural environment while experiencing modern amenities in their RVs from RVshare.

National Forests Near Mary Esther, FL

Apalachicola National Forest is a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ts and RVers. It is the largest national forest in Florida, spanning over 632,890 acres. There are numerous recreational activities to enjoy here, including hiking, camping, bird watching, stargazing, biking, fishing, and boating. Edward Ball Wakulla Springs State Park and Ochlockonee River State Park are also in close proximity to the forest.If you're willing to drive further north into Alabama from Mary Esther, Tuskegee National Forest and Conecuh National Forest both offer unique experiences worth checking out. Established in November 1959, Tuskegee National Forest is home to the Tuskegee Airmen National Historic Site and Tuskegee Institute National Historic Site. The forest spans over 11,252 acres of land with plenty of opportunities for outdoor exploration. Conecuh National Forest spans over 83,861 acres of land with plenty of trails for hiking and biking as well as hunting opportunities during designated seasons.No matter which national forest you choose to visit near Mary Esther on your RV trip, you're guaranteed an unforgettable time surrounded by nature's beauty.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

- Hurlburt Field AFB FamCamp is a popular RV park near Mary Esther, Florida. - This RV park offers full-hookup sites, back-in/pull-through sites, and amenities like showers, laundry facilities and Wi-Fi.- Another great option for RV campgrounds near Mary Esther is the Destin West RV Resort. This resort has 54 full-hookup sites, a pool/hot tub area, cell reception and Wi-Fi.- If you're looking for more luxurious accommodations, you can check out the Destin West Bayside RV Resort. They offer amenities like access to Ramada Inn amenities and laundry facilities.- Lastly, Magnolia Beach Campground is another popular campground near Mary Esther that offers cable TV and strong cell reception.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Motorhome Near Mary Esther, FL

Do I maintain or service the motorhome rental during my rental period?

No, it is the responsibility of the RVshare owner to ensure the motorhome is properly maintained and serviced before your rental period. Just take good care of your rental and keep it clean.

Are there any special driving considerations or techniques I should know when operating a motorhome rental in Mary Esther, FL?

Yes, motorhomes are larger and heavier than most passenger vehicles, so it is important to allow for more time and space when turning, merging, or stopping. Additionally, it is recommended to drive slower than the posted speed limit and to use caution when driving in windy or wet conditions.

How do I properly level and stabilize a motorhome at my campsite or RV park?

Motorhomes typically have built-in leveling jacks or blocks that can be adjusted to ensure the RV is level and stable. Some RV parks may also provide leveling pads or blocks if needed. Discuss your campsite with the RV owner ahead of time and they can provide you guidance on stabilizing.

What kind of maintenance or upkeep do I need to perform on the interior and exterior during my rental period?

You should keep the interior clean and tidy, empty waste tanks as needed, and report any damages or malfunctions to the RVshare owner. Exterior maintenance such as checking tire pressure is also recommended.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when operating a motorhome rental?

Motorhomes are not typically known for their fuel efficiency, but there are steps you can take to improve gas mileage such as driving at a lower speed, avoiding excessive idling, and keeping tires properly inflated.
